一、用户权限管理 1. 查看帮助信息使用 mysql 命令连接上 MySQL 服务后可以使用 help 命令查看帮助信息,例如: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26
当数据库服务器资源有剩余时,为了充分利用剩余资源可以通过部署 MySQL 多实例提升资源利用率, 下面演示如何在一台机上安装 MySQL 多实例 下载 MySQL 5.7 二进制包 1 [root@10-13-90-34 src]#
下载 MySQL 5.7 二进制包 1 wget https://cdn.mysql.com/archives/mysql-5.7/mysql-5.7.28-linux-glibc2.12-x86_64.tar.gz 解压并建立软链接(/usr/local/mysql) 1 2 tar xzf mysql-5.7.28-linux-glibc2.12-x86_64.tar.gz -C /usr/local/ ln -s /usr/local/mysql-5.7.28-linux-glibc2.12-x86_64/ /usr/local/mysql 配置环境变量 1 2 echo 'export PATH=/usr/local/mysql/bin:$PATH' > /etc/profile.d/mysql.sh source /etc/profile 初始化前准备工
使用 phpMyAdmin 登录任意数据库服务器安装完成 phpMyAdmin 后, 如果你想在页面手动输入服务器地址进行连接,可以参考以下配置项 官方文档: https://docs.phpmyadmin.net/en/latest/config.html#cfg_AllowArbitraryServer 编辑 libraries/config.default.php 找到 $cfg['AllowArbitraryServer'] 配置项,将值改为
众所周知,PHP 是 LAMP 应用程序(WordPress,Joomla,Drupal和Media Wiki等)中最重要的部分。 现在,大多数这些应用程序
redis 插件 1 2 3 4 5 6 7 8 9 10 11 wget http://pecl.php.net/get/redis-4.2.0.tgz tar xzf redis-4.2.0.tgz cd redis-4.2.0 /usr/local/php/bin/phpize ./configure --with-php-config=/usr/local/php/bin/php-config make && make install cat > /etc/php/conf.d/redis.ini << EOF [redis] extension=redis.so EOF RabbitMQ 插件安装 rabbitmq-c 1 2 3 4 5 6 wget -O rabbitmq-c-0.9.0.tar.gz https://github.com/alanxz/rabbitmq-c/archive/v0.9.0.tar.gz tar xzf rabbitmq-c-0.9.0.tar.gz cd rabbitmq-c-0.9.0 mkdir build && cd build cmake -DCMAKE_INSTALL_PREFIX=/usr/local/rabbitmq-c .. cmake --build . --target install
环境准备准备编译环境 1 yum install -y gcc gcc-c++ make cmak autoconf 安装相关依赖 1 2 3 4 5 yum install -y libmcrypt libmcrypt-devel mcrypt mhash yum install -y gmp-devel libxml2-devel openssl-devel bzip2-devel / libcurl-devel libjpeg-devel libpng-devel freetype-devel / libmcrypt-devel readline-devel libxslt-devel libicu-devel / gettext-devel libc-client-devel pam-devel 编译安装 1 2 3 4 5 6 7 8
由于 rabbitmq 是 erlang 开发的所以依赖 erlang, 准备三台服务器并配置好主机名, 并以下信息写入三台服务器的 hosts. 1 2 3 mq1 192.168.1.11 mq2 192.168.1.12 mq3 192.168.1.13 1. 配置 erlang, rabbitmq YUM 仓库 1 2 curl -s https://packagecloud.io/install/repositories/rabbitmq/erlang/script.rpm.sh | bash curl -s https://packagecloud.io/install/repositories/rabbitmq/rabbitmq-server/script.rpm.sh |
任务需求需要将一台服务器指定目录中的文件实时同步到另一台服务器上,目录路径 /data/www/pic, 此时我们通过 Rsync + Inotify 来实现。 服务器如下 192.168.145.131: 文件发布推送,客户端 192.168.145.132: 文件
原因:由于公司使用 CentOS6.5 充当网关,为了避免麻烦给同事们一个个地去配置 IP 地址, 所以决定安装使用 dhcp 来自动分配 IP(之前是真一个一个去给他们配置 IP 地址